## Configuration

Pairwise, our matching service, gets twitchy about GC pauses under load — long stop-the-world pauses make matches time out and retries pile up. We tune the heap via env vars rather than flags so the release pipeline stays simple. Copy `env.sample` to `.env`, set `PAIRWISE_HEAP_TARGET` to something sane for the box, and then add the telemetry credential on the next line:

sealed setting: ARCHIVE_KEY3=8d0

- [ ] Step 7: Archive cold storage buckets (Glacierline tier). Confirm both ceremony witnesses are present, verify bucket manifests match the Oxbow ledger, then seal the archive key shares. Plugin authors may observe but not handle shares. Once sealed, the archive index itself is encrypted and can only be reopened with the passphrase below.

vault phrase of badup-hahig = tamael-aldael-kelmir-istael-fenok-istwyn-tamius-jorath-oliion

Subject: Key rotation — Mergewell dedup service

Rotated the Mergewell credential today. Context for future maintainers: the dedup job matches customer records on normalized name plus postal fields, then merges into the canonical record. Old key is revoked effective immediately; any cron jobs still referencing it will fail silently, so check the merge logs after deploy. Rotation cadence is quarterly going forward. Config lives in the usual ops repo. The replacement key for the dedup endpoint is below.

gateway credential: kto3_qfe